Why Use Barbless Hooks. Barbs obviously make it much harder for a hook to come out of a fish’s mouth, but when the hooks do come out, they can do more damage than barbless hooks, as demonstrated in the video above. The hook gape is the empty space between the hook's shaft and point. Larger gapes are required for larger species of fish. The hook point is the sharp end of the hook. Fishing hook barbs are often located at the end of the point, designed to penetrate the fish. Preparing to Set Your Hook: Keep Your Line Tight. The number one rule of fishing is to keep your line tight. You’re looking for minimal slack between the tip of your rod and your hook. With a J-hook, when a fish bites, a traditional highly forceful hookset is the norm to drive the hook home. Try that with a circle hook on the end of your line, and you’ll yank the hook right out of the fish’s mouth. Also called an inline hook, the point of a non-offset hook lines up with the eye and shank. Because of this, non-offset hooks decrease the chance of gut hooking a fish as they're less likely to get caught on anything when coming back out of the fish’s mouth/throat.
